JAVASCRIPT写的智能判断网页编码 并转换的完整例子
来源:互联网 发布:淘宝买家会员帐号提取 编辑:程序博客网 时间:2024/05/01 18:13
<%@LANGUAGE="JAVASCRIPT" CODEPAGE="65001"%>
<html>
<head>
<meta http-equiv="Content-Type" content="text/html; charset=utf-8">
<title>XMLHTTP</title>
</head>
<%
Server.ScriptTimeout=9999999;
function send_request(url) {
var codedtext;
http_request = Server.CreateObject("Microsoft.XMLHTTP");
http_request.Open("GET",url,false);
http_request.Send(null);
if (http_request.ReadyState == 4){
//自动判断编码开始
var charresult = http_request.ResponseText.match(/CharSet=(/S+)/">/i);
if (charresult != null){
var Cset = charresult[1];
}else{Cset = "gb2312"}//对获取不到的网站采用gb2312编码,可自行更改
//自动判断编码结束
codedtext = bytesToBSTR(http_request.Responsebody,Cset);
}else{
codedtext = "Erro";
}
return(codedtext);
}
function bytesToBSTR(body,Cset){
var objstream;
objstream = Server.CreateObject("Adodb.Stream");
objstream.Type = 1;
objstream.Mode = 3;
objstream.Open();
objstream.Write(body);
objstream.Position = 0;
objstream.Type = 2;
objstream.Charset = Cset;
bytesToBSTR = objstream.Readtext;
objstream.Close;
return(bytesToBSTR);
}
%>
<body>
<% Response.Write(send_request("http://www.blueidea.com/tech/program/2006/3280.asp")) %>
</body>
</html>
- JAVASCRIPT写的智能判断网页编码 并转换的完整例子
- 网页编码的转换
- PHP判断字符串编码是否utf8并转换的方法
- PHP判断字符串编码是否utf8并转换的方法
- PHP判断字符串编码是否utf8并转换的方法
- Webstorm的Javascript的IDE智能编码
- 判断网页的编码方式 python
- javascript写的图片转换
- VS2005写ICE的一个完整的例子
- 网页编码文字转换(Emeditor的脚本)
- Quartz CronTrigger最完整配置说明和写的例子。
- 如何完整的判断网页是否有错误
- 用javascript写的热键例子
- Javascript编写判断是否闰年的例子
- // 完整的COM例子
- 完整的struts2例子
- webservice 完整的例子
- rrdtool的完整例子
- VC Debug 小技巧——伪符号
- css圆角框
- 解决SQL Server的TEXT、IMAGE类型字段的长度限制
- AJAX开发简略
- IE里面打印HTML页面时的分页控制
- JAVASCRIPT写的智能判断网页编码 并转换的完整例子
- IT技术人员的心理状态
- 表格线条细化的html代码
- 在vs2005中如何设置使用Jmail收发邮件
- 对视频网站的运营要有国有控股的参加,网上购买彩票的取消,网店的开设要有营业执照等一点随想
- win 2003 文件夹 文件 拒绝访问 无法访问 终极解决方法 您无权查看或编辑目前 的权限设置;但是,您可以取得所有权或更改审核设置
- sql server 修改列名
- Teamplate 工作流开发技术总结(2)
- JAVA 数据库的操作方法 基类